Title: Materials Data on V5Si3 by Materials Project

Abstract

V5Si3 crystallizes in the tetragonal I4/mcm space group. The structure is three-dimensional. there are two inequivalent V+2.40+ sites. In the first V+2.40+ site, V+2.40+ is bonded to six Si4- atoms to form a mixture of distorted face, edge, and corner-sharing VSi6 pentagonal pyramids. There are a spread of V–Si bond distances ranging from 2.49–2.72 Å. In the second V+2.40+ site, V+2.40+ is bonded in a distorted hexagonal planar geometry to two equivalent V+2.40+ and four equivalent Si4- atoms. Both V–V bond lengths are 2.36 Å. All V–Si bond lengths are 2.51 Å. There are two inequivalent Si4- sites. In the first Si4- site, Si4- is bonded in a 10-coordinate geometry to ten V+2.40+ atoms. In the second Si4- site, Si4- is bonded in a 10-coordinate geometry to eight equivalent V+2.40+ and two equivalent Si4- atoms. Both Si–Si bond lengths are 2.36 Å.
